在前端开发中,我们经常会使用 npm 包来管理项目依赖。当项目的依赖库很多时,node_modules 文件夹会变得非常大,占用本地磁盘空间。虽然这个文件夹的作用是很重要的,但在有些情况下,如果你想删除它,也是没问题的。不过手动删除的话,工作量较大,也容易出错。今天介绍一个轻松解决这一问题的 npm 包:rm-node-modules。
rm-node-modules 简介
rm-node-modules 是一个方便快捷的命令行工具,可以帮助你轻松地删除指定目录下的 node_modules 文件夹。它支持 Windows、Linux 和 macOS 等操作系统,并且是在全局安装的 npm 包。使用很简单,一行命令就可以完成。
安装 rm-node-modules
要使用 rm-node-modules,必须先安装它。在命令行中输入以下命令:
npm install -g rm-node-modules
这个命令会在全局环境中安装 rm-node-modules。安装完成后,就可以使用它了。
使用 rm-node-modules
rm-node-modules 使用很简单。在命令行中进入项目目录,然后输入以下命令:
rm-node-modules
这个命令会删除当前目录以及其所有子目录中的 node_modules 文件夹。如果你只想删除指定目录中的 node_modules,可以在命令后面加上目录路径,如:
rm-node-modules /path/to/your/directory
此时,只会删除 /path/to/your/directory 中的 node_modules 文件夹,而不会影响其他文件夹。
如果删除过程中出现问题,rm-node-modules 会显示一个错误信息。你可以根据错误信息来解决问题,然后重新运行命令。
示例代码
下面是一个示例代码,演示如何使用 rm-node-modules:
// 安装 rm-node-modules npm install -g rm-node-modules // 进入项目目录 cd /path/to/your/project // 删除当前目录以及其所有子目录中的 node_modules 文件夹 rm-node-modules
总结
rm-node-modules 是一个非常方便的 npm 包,可以帮助你轻松地删除指定目录下的 node_modules 文件夹。它简单易用,操作过程也很安全。如果你在开发中遇到了 node_modules 文件夹过大的问题,可以使用 rm-node-modules 来解决。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600557c481e8991b448d4cd8